A light ray is incident on a horizontal plane mirror at an angle of `45^(@)`. At what angle should a second plane mirror be placed in order that the refelcted ray finally be reflected horizontally form the second mirror, as shown in figure A. `theta=30^(@)`B. `theta=24^(@)`C. `theta=22.5^(@)`D. `theta=67.5^(@)` |
|
Answer» (c) From figure `CD=` emergent ray and `CD` is parallel to `PQ` and `BC` is a line intersecting these parallel lines, So, `/_DCB/_CBQ=180^(@)` `/_DCN+/_NCB+/_CBQ=180^(@)` `alpha+alpha+45^(@)=180^(@)` `alpha=67.5^(@)` But `/_NCS=90^(@)` So, second mirror is at an angle of `22.5^(@)` with horizontal . |
